About
This webinar will present the findings of our latest brief, prepared under the leadership of UNCTAD with substantive input from Circular Innovation Lab: “A Consumer Label on Plastics and Plastics Substitutes.”
As global attention on plastics intensifies, consumer labels have emerged as a key tool for driving transparency, preventing greenwashing, and aligning consumer behavior with circular economy goals. Yet, inconsistent standards and unclear communication continue to limit their effectiveness.
Therefore, this discussion will highlight how well-designed labelling systems can empower consumers, strengthen recycling, and support international cooperation on sustainable trade.
